Covert Brain Infarction: Antiplatelet and Lipid-Lowering Treatments

We are studying whether adding antiplatelet and cholesterol-lowering medications can help patients with covert brain infarctions reduce serious health risks. This trial will also assess the impact on cognitive health and overall mortality.

Acetylsalicylic Acid
Acetylsalicylic acid is a substance that reduces pain, fever, and inflammation and can help prevent blood clots.
Atorvastatin
Atorvastatin is a substance that lowers bad cholesterol to help reduce the risk of heart attacks and strokes.
Clopidogrel
Clopidogrel is a substance that helps prevent blood clots by stopping platelets from sticking together, lowering the risk of heart attack and stroke.
